Laven R, Chambers P, Stafford K. Using non-steroidal anti-inflammatory drugs around calving: maximizing comfort, productivity and fertility. Vet J 2012; 192:8-12. [PMID: 22487241 DOI: 10.1016/j.tvjl.2011.10.023] [Citation(s) in RCA: 39] [Impact Index Per Article: 3.3]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/03/2011] [Revised: 10/14/2011] [Accepted: 10/27/2011] [Indexed: 11/28/2022]
Abstract
Non-steroidal anti-inflammatory drugs (NSAIDs) have analgesic, anti-inflammatory, anti-endotoxic and anti-pyretic effects in cattle. As such, they could be expected to have significant effects in cows and calves in the post-calving period. This review evaluates the published data on the use of NSAIDs in the dam and its calf after dystocia, the impact of NSAIDs on uterine involution, the restoration of ovarian function and prevention and treatment of the metritis complex, and the benefits of using NSAIDs in the recumbent cow. Overall, the published data are very limited, despite frequent use of NSAIDs by veterinarians in the post-calving cow, and the small number of published studies focus on blanket treatment of calving cows rather than targeted treatment after dystocia. Blanket treatment had no economic benefit; indeed, some studies reported adverse effects, such as pyrexia and increased risk of metritis. There is even less information on the value of treating calves with NSAIDs after dystocia, despite significant tissue damage which may benefit from NSAID use. Appreciably more studies have evaluated the influence of NSAIDs on uterine and ovarian function, but clinical relevance is limited. In cows with a normal puerperium, prolonged treatment with NSAIDs may slow the restoration of normal function, but most reported studies are small and use NSAIDs more frequently and for longer periods than is common in general practice. The evidence of a clinical benefit in cows with puerperal disease is limited and equivocal, and the evidence base for the use of NSAIDs in the treatment of recumbent cows is also small, even though an expert panel concluded that NSAIDs were a key aspect of veterinary treatment of downer cows. The lack of evidence identified by this review supports the contention that NSAIDs are likely to be under-used and sub-optimally prescribed in the post calving period. Further research on the use of NSAIDs in the post-calving cow and calf is required.

Serological screening for Coxiella burnetii infection and related reproductive performance in high producing dairy cows. Res Vet Sci 2011; 93:67-73. [PMID: 21862091 DOI: 10.1016/j.rvsc.2011.07.017] [Citation(s) in RCA: 19]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/19/2011] [Revised: 07/13/2011] [Accepted: 07/22/2011] [Indexed: 11/22/2022]
Abstract
The possible relationship between Coxiella-seropositivity and the reproductive performance of cows during the previous year to the serological screening was examined in three high producing dairy herds. The herds had a history of subfertility (<25% of pregnancies for the total number of AI), abortion (>18% abortions) and a positive polymerase chain reaction test for Coxiella burnetii in the bulk tank milk with an excretion higher than 10(4)Coxiella /ml for all three herds. Antibodies against C. burnetii were detected in 50.2% of the 781 parous cows analyzed. Coxiella seropositivity was linked to placenta retention, to changes in the interval from parturition to conception (with the lowest interval parturition-conception for cows with low level of seropositivity), early pregnancy (cows becoming pregnant before Day 90 postpartum) and maintenance of gestation during the early fetal period, while it failed to affect rates of abortion after Day 90 of gestation or stillbirth.

Dilly M, Hambruch N, Haeger JD, Pfarrer C. Epidermal growth factor (EGF) induces motility and upregulates MMP-9 and TIMP-1 in bovine trophoblast cells. Mol Reprod Dev 2010; 77:622-9. [PMID: 20578063 DOI: 10.1002/mrd.21197] [Citation(s) in RCA: 25]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/10/2022]
Abstract
Differentiation and restricted invasion/migration of trophoblast cells are crucial for feto-maternal communication in the synepitheliochorial placenta of cattle. EGF is expressed in the bovine placenta and likely regulates these cell properties. As cell migration and motility rely on the degradation of extracellular matrix we hypothesize that EGF is involved in the regulation of the MMP-9/TIMP-1 balance and thus could influence trophoblast migration, tissue remodeling, and the release of the fetal membranes after parturition. The aim of this in vitro study was to examine EGF-mediated effects on cell motility, proliferation, and MMP-9 and TIMP-1 expression in cultured bovine trophoblast cells. We used a trophoblast cell line (F3) derived from bovine placentomes to examine the influence of EGF on MMP-9 and TIMP-1 expression by semiquantitative RT-PCR and MMP activity by zymography. Migration assays were performed using a Boyden chamber and cell motility was measured by time-lapse analyses. To identify the involved signaling cascades, phosphorylation of mitogen-activated protein kinase (MAPK) 42/44 and Akt was detected by Western blot. EGF treatment increased both the abundance of MMP-9 and TIMP-1 mRNAs and the proteolytic activity of MMP-9. Furthermore, EGF stimulated proliferation and migration of F3 cells. Addition of specific inhibitors of MAPK (PD98059) and/or PI3K (LY294002) activation abolished or reduced EGF-induced effects in all experiments. In conclusion, EGF-mediated effects stimulate migration and proliferation of bovine trophoblast cells and may be involved in bovine placental tissue remodeling and postpartum release of fetal membranes.

Shenavai S, Hoffmann B, Dilly M, Pfarrer C, Özalp GR, Caliskan C, Seyrek-Intas K, Schuler G. Use of the progesterone (P4) receptor antagonist aglepristone to characterize the role of P4 withdrawal for parturition and placental release in cows. Reproduction 2010; 140:623-32. [DOI: 10.1530/rep-10-0182] [Citation(s) in RCA: 12] [Impact Index Per Article: 0.9]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/08/2022]
Abstract
In late pregnant cows, progesterone (P4) is mainly of luteal origin. However, the trophoblast may provide high local P4concentrations in the uterus. To test for the importance of a complete P4withdrawal for parturition-related processes and placental release, the P4receptor (PGR) blocker aglepristone (Ap) was administered to three cows on days 270 and 271 of pregnancy. A complete opening of the cervix was observed 46.5±7.3 h after the start of treatment. However, expulsion of the calves was impaired obviously because of insufficient myometrial activity, and placental membranes were retained for at least 10 days. Measurement of P4concentrations indicated that PGR blockage induced luteolysis. To investigate the role of P4withdrawal for the prepartal tissue remodeling of the placentomes, the caruncular epithelium was evaluated by morphometry, and the percentage of trophoblast giant cells (TGCs) relative to the total number of trophoblast cells were assessed. Caruncular epithelium in Ap-treated cows (D272+Ap) was immature (30.5±3.3%) and not different from untreated controls (elected cesarean section (CS) on day 272; D272-CS; 31.5±1.4%), whereas it was significantly reduced at normal term (D280.5±1.3; 21.0±6.1%;P=0.011). Correspondingly, the percentage of TGCs were 20.1±1.4 in D272+Ap, 22.1±4.8 in D272-CS, and 9.8±3.9 at term (P=0.001). No effect was detected on placental estrogen synthesis. The results showed that in late pregnant cows, P4withdrawal only induces a limited spectrum of the processes related to normal parturition and is not a crucial factor for the prepartal tissue remodeling in placentomes and the timely release of the placenta.

Risk factors for clinical endometritis in postpartum dairy cattle. Theriogenology 2010; 74:127-34. [PMID: 20207407 DOI: 10.1016/j.theriogenology.2010.01.023] [Citation(s) in RCA: 100] [Impact Index Per Article: 7.1]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/23/2009] [Revised: 01/15/2010] [Accepted: 01/31/2010] [Indexed: 01/07/2023]
Abstract
Bacterial contamination of the uterine lumen after parturition occurs in most dairy cattle. The presence of clinical endometritis beyond three weeks post partum depends on the balance between microbes, host immunity, and other environmental or animal factors. The present study tested the hypothesis that clinical endometritis is associated with animal factors, such as retained fetal membranes, assisted calving and twins, as well as fecal contamination of the environment. The association between selected risk factors and the lactational incidence risk of clinical endometritis was examined in 293 animals from four dairy herds. Multivariate analysis was used to identify risk factors and quantify their relative risk (RR) and population attributable fraction (PAF) based on the proportion of cows exposed to each factor. The lactational incidence of clinical endometritis was 27% and significant risk factors for clinical endometritis were retained fetal membranes (RR=3.6), assisted calving (RR=1.7), stillbirth (RR=3.1), vulval angle (RR=1.3), primparity (RR=1.8), and male offspring (RR=1.5) but not the cleanliness of the environment or the animal. The highest PAF was associated with male offspring (0.6) so the use of sexed semen has the greatest potential to reduce the incidence of clinical endometritis. The dominant association between retained fetal membranes and clinical endometritis was supported by an expert panel of clinicians. The risk factors for clinical endometritis appear to be associated with trauma of the female genital tract and disruption of the physical barriers to infection rather than fecal contamination.

Drillich M, Klever N, Heuwieser W. Comparison of Two Management Strategies for Retained Fetal Membranes on Small Dairy Farms in Germany. J Dairy Sci 2007; 90:4275-81. [PMID: 17699046 DOI: 10.3168/jds.2007-0131] [Citation(s) in RCA: 18] [Impact Index Per Article: 1.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/19/2022]
Abstract
The objective of this study was to compare 2 strategies for the management of dairy cows having retained fetal membranes (RFM) with regard to clinical traits, milk yield, and reproductive performance. In contrast to recent studies evaluating optimal strategies for the management of cows with RFM, this trial was conducted on small dairy farms with 26 to 166 cows per herd. In the systemic (SYS) group (n = 116), cows having RFM and a rectal temperature > or = 39.5 degrees C were treated with 1 mg/kg of body weight of ceftiofur on 3 to 5 consecutive days. The RFM cows without fever remained untreated. In the intrauterine (IUT) group (n = 115), all RFM cows received an intrauterine treatment with 6 g of tetracycline on 3 consecutive days combined with an attempt to remove the fetal membranes manually. The IUT cows with a fever received an additional systemic treatment with 10 mg/kg of body weight of amoxicillin on 3 to 5 consecutive days. Body temperature, daily milk yield, prevalence of vaginal discharge 28 to 35 d in milk (DIM), and reproductive performance traits within 200 DIM were monitored. The proportion of cows experiencing fever within 5 d after enrollment was greater in SYS compared with IUT. The proportion of cows with mucopurulent or purulent vaginal discharge 28 to 34 DIM did not differ between the groups. Furthermore, no significant differences between groups were found in daily milk yield in the first 10 d after enrollment, or in reproductive performance or proportion of cows culled. Significant differences in the proportion of cows with a fever in SYS and IUT have not been reported in studies with similar study designs conducted on large dairy farms. Further results on milk yield and reproductive performance, however, support findings that a management strategy for RFM based on a selective systemic treatment of feverish cows is at least as efficacious as a strategy based on intrauterine treatments of all cows and a systemic antibiotic treatment of feverish cows.

Seifi HA, Dalir-Naghadeh B, Farzaneh N, Mohri M, Gorji-Dooz M. Metabolic Changes in Cows with or without Retained Fetal Membranes in Transition Period. ACTA ACUST UNITED AC 2007; 54:92-7. [PMID: 17305972 DOI: 10.1111/j.1439-0442.2007.00896.x] [Citation(s) in RCA: 11] [Impact Index Per Article: 0.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/28/2022]
Abstract
The purpose of the study was to evaluate the effect of retained fetal membranes (RFM) on serum minerals and energy- and protein-related metabolites in dairy cows at a herd with a recent history of fatty liver syndrome. Forty-seven multiparous Holstein cows were selected during transition period. Nine cows had RFM longer than 24 h after calving. Blood samples were obtained on prepartum days 21 and 7 and postpartum days 7 and 21. We used repeated measure procedure of anova to evaluate the effect of RFM on serum metabolites. Cows with RFM had significantly higher concentrations of beta-hydroxybutyrate, non-esterified fatty acids and triglycerides after calving, but had lower concentrations of cholesterol during transition period. The concentrations of serum albumin and blood urea nitrogen were also significantly lower in RFM-affected cows than non-affected ones after parturition. Our results suggested that negative energy balance (NEB) postpartum was associated with RFM in dairy cattle. However, our findings did not reveal a cause and effect relationship with respect to the role of NEB as a possible risk factor for RFM.

Bourne N, Laven R, Wathes DC, Martinez T, McGowan M. A meta-analysis of the effects of Vitamin E supplementation on the incidence of retained foetal membranes in dairy cows. Theriogenology 2007; 67:494-501. [PMID: 17007917 DOI: 10.1016/j.theriogenology.2006.08.015] [Citation(s) in RCA: 28] [Impact Index Per Article: 1.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/24/2006] [Revised: 08/29/2006] [Accepted: 08/30/2006] [Indexed: 11/29/2022]
Abstract
A meta-analysis was performed to consolidate the results of studies which have evaluated the effects of Vitamin E supplementation during the dry period on the risk of retained foetal membranes (RFM) in the dairy cow. Twenty studies demonstrated a beneficial response to Vitamin E whilst 21 found no benefit and 3 reported an increase in the incidence of RFM in treated cows. The odds ratios (OR) of the available studies exhibited significant heterogeneity, so multivariable logistic regression analysis was performed to enable the identification of factors associated with the response to Vitamin E supplementation. Our multivariable analysis included parity and Vitamin E supplementation (control/treated) in the model, because all other factors were co-linear. Results indicated that Vitamin E supplementation led to a reduction in the incidence of RFM. A second multivariable analysis was undertaken on a subset of the data including only supplemented cows to determine the influence of supplementation factors on the risk of RFM. All factors were co-linear with each other, therefore, only type of Vitamin E supplementation was included in this analysis. The regression model demonstrated that administration of the synthetic Vitamin E alpha-tocopheryl acetate was associated with a lower risk of RFM than treatment with natural Vitamin E (alpha-tocopherol) (P=0.047, OR=0.49), whereas the difference between the synthetic Vitamin E alpha-tocopherol acetate and natural Vitamin E just failed to attain statistical significance (P=0.059, OR=0.53). Overall the analyses indicate that Vitamin E supplementation during the dry period is associated with a reduced risk of RFM, and that the synthetic forms of Vitamin E are more effective than the natural compound.

Abstract
The cause of low fertility in dairy cows is multifactorial. Poor nutrition during the dry and early postpartum periods results in reduced glucose, insulin, insulin-like growth factor (IGF-I) and low LH pulse frequency with concomitant increases in beta-hydroxy butyrate, non-esterified fatty acids (NEFA) and triacylglycerol. Cows must mobilize large lipid, but also some protein reserves, with a consequent increased incidence of such metabolic disorders as hypocalcaemia, acidosis, ketosis, fatty liver and displaced abomasums. The occurrence of milk fever and ketosis affects uterine contractions, delays calving and increases the risk of retained foetal membranes (RFM) and endometritis. The nutritional risk factors that cause RFM are hypocalcaemia, high body condition score (BCS) at calving and deficiencies in Vitamin E and selenium. The risk factors for endometritis are hypocalcaemia, RFM, high triacylglycerol and NEFA. Thus, metabolic disorders predispose cows to gynaecological disorders, thereby reducing reproductive efficiency. Cows that are overconditioned at calving or those that lose excess body weight are more likely to have a prolonged interval to first oestrus, thereby prolonging days open. Nutritionally induced postpartum anoestrus is characterized by turnover of dominant follicles incapable of producing sufficient oestradiol to induce ovulation due to reduced LH pulse frequency. High nutrition can also increase metabolic clearance rate of steroid hormones such as progesterone or oestradiol. Lower concentrations of oestradiol on the day of oestrus are highly correlated with the occurrence of suboestrus, thereby making the detection of oestrus in high yielding cows even more difficult. Nutrition also affects conception rate (CR) to AI. Cows that develop hypocalcaemia, ketosis, acidosis or displaced abomasums have lower CRs and take longer to become pregnant. Excessive loss of BCS and excess protein content of the ration can reduce CR while supplemental fats that attenuate the production of F2alpha can improve CR. The increased metabolic clearance rate of progesterone (P4), which decreases blood concentrations during early embryo cleavage up to the blastocyst stage is associated with decreased CRs. In conclusion, poor nutritional management of the dairy cow, particularly before and after calving, is a key driver of infertility.

Drillich M, Reichert U, Mahlstedt M, Heuwieser W. Comparison of Two Strategies for Systemic Antibiotic Treatment of Dairy Cows with Retained Fetal Membranes: Preventive vs. Selective Treatment. J Dairy Sci 2006; 89:1502-8. [PMID: 16606720 DOI: 10.3168/jds.s0022-0302(06)72217-2] [Citation(s) in RCA: 27]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/19/2022]
Abstract
The objective of this study was to evaluate the efficacy of a blanket systemic preventive treatment (PT) of cows having retained fetal membranes (RFM) with 1 mg/kg of ceftiofur administered the first day after calving regardless of their body temperature. This strategy was compared with a selective treatment (ST) strategy in which only cows having RFM and a rectal temperature > or = 39.5 degrees C within 10 d postpartum received ceftiofur. Cows that retained their fetal membranes for at least 24 h after calving were allocated to 2 groups. Rectal temperature was measured daily for 10 d postpartum. Sixty PT cows having RFM received a daily ceftiofur (1 mg/kg of body weight) treatment, administered subcutaneously during the first 3 d after diagnosis of RFM. If rectal temperature was > or = 39.5 degrees C after 3 daily treatments, cows received ceftiofur for 2 more days. Therapy in 53 ST cows was based on selective administration of ceftiofur to cows having fever during the first 10 d postpartum. Treatment was conducted for 3 to 5 consecutive days as described for PT cows, beginning on the first day of fever. In both groups, manual removal of the placenta was not attempted and antibiotic drugs were not administered into the uterus. For every cow having RFM enrolled in PT or ST, 1 cow without RFM that had calved on the same day was enrolled in a healthy control group (n = 113). All cows received two 25-mg doses of PGF(2alpha): 1 dose between 18 and 24 d and 1 dose between 32 and 38 d postpartum. The PT did not reduce the proportion of cows experiencing fever during 10 d postpartum compared with ST cows (71.7 vs. 69.8%). Results were compared using logistic regression models and survival analyses. The artificial insemination submission rate between 42 and 62 d postpartum was greater in PT (41.2 vs. 20.8 vs. 24.5%), but total conception rate was less in ST and control cows, respectively (25.0 vs. 38.9 vs. 36.2%). In this trial, a preventive systemic antibiotic treatment of all cows having RFM was not superior to a selective antibiotic treatment of cows only in case of fever.

Drillich M, Mahlstedt M, Reichert U, Tenhagen BA, Heuwieser W. Strategies to Improve the Therapy of Retained Fetal Membranes in Dairy Cows. J Dairy Sci 2006; 89:627-35. [PMID: 16428632 DOI: 10.3168/jds.s0022-0302(06)72126-9] [Citation(s) in RCA: 42] [Impact Index Per Article: 2.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/19/2022]
Abstract
In this field trial, a protocol for the treatment of retained fetal membranes (RFM) without any intrauterine therapy was compared with 3 protocols based on the intrauterine use of antibiotic pills (AP), the manual removal (MR) of the fetal membranes, or the combination of both (PR). The study was conducted on 5 commercial dairy farms in Germany. Cows with RFM for at least 24 h after calving were assigned to 1 of 4 treatment groups. Cows of all groups with a rectal temperature >or= 39.5 degrees C received a systemic antibiotic treatment with ceftiofur (1 mg/kg per d) for 3 to 5 consecutive days. In case of continued fever after 5 treatments, cows received a different antibiotic as an escape therapy. In the reference group (REF; n = 131), cows did not receive any additional treatment. All cows in group AP (n = 119) received intrauterine treatment with antibiotic pills consisting of 1,000 mg of ampicillin and 1,000 mg of cloxacillin for 3 consecutive days. In group MR (n = 121), an attempt was made to remove the fetal membranes manually, but uterine pills were not administered. In group PR (n = 130), an attempt was made to remove the fetal membranes manually and all cows received a local antibiotic treatment as in group AP. All cows received 2 doses of 25 mg of PGF(2alpha): one dose between 18 and 24 d and another between 32 and 38 d postpartum. Statistical analyses were performed using binary logistic regression models and survival analyses with group REF as reference. Of all animals, 79.8% had a body temperature of >or= 39.5 degrees C at least once within 10 d postpartum and were treated with ceftiofur. Occurrence of fever within 10 d postpartum was significantly lower in groups AP and PR compared with reference group REF, but was not different between groups MR and REF. Risk of receiving an escape therapy in case of fever after 5 treatments with ceftiofur did not differ among groups. Reproductive performance measures did not differ significantly between group REF and any of the comparison groups. Compared with a treatment protocol based only on systemic treatment with antibiotics for cows with a fever, neither intrauterine antibiotics nor manual removal of fetal membranes alone or in combination reduced proportions of cows needing an escape therapy nor did those treatments improve reproductive measures in the current lactation. Systemic treatment alone based on elevated rectal temperature was effective and reduced use of antibiotics compared with therapies that included intrauterine antibiotics.

Sevinga M, Vrijenhoek T, Hesselinks JW, Barkema HW, Groen AF. Effect of inbreeding on the incidence of retained placenta in Friesian horses1. J Anim Sci 2004; 82:982-6. [PMID: 15080317 DOI: 10.2527/2004.824982x] [Citation(s) in RCA: 34] [Impact Index Per Article: 1.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/13/2022] Open
Abstract
This study was motivated by the hypothesis that the incidence of retained placenta (RP) in Friesian horses is associated with inbreeding. The objectives were to 1) calculate the inbreeding rate in the total registered Friesian horse population; 2) study the association of the inbreeding coefficient of the foal and the mare with the incidence of RP; and 3) study the heritability of RP in Friesian mares after normal foalings. Data from the total registered Friesian horse population from 1879 to 2000 (52,392 individuals) were collected from the registration files of the Friesian Horse Studbook. In 1999 and 2000, 495 parturitions in 436 mares were studied. From 1979 to 2000, the inbreeding rate of the total population was 1.9% per generation. The regression coefficients for the regression of the incidence of RP on inbreeding coefficients of the foal and the mare were 0.12 +/- 0.052 and -0.016 +/- 0.019, respectively. Mean heritability estimates of RP as a foal trait and as a mare trait were 0.046 +/- 0.088 and 0.105 +/- 0.123, respectively. It was concluded that, in order to avoid a further increase in the incidence of RP in Friesian mares, a decrease in the inbreeding rate by increasing the effective breeding population is required. Furthermore, the findings indicate that the high incidence of RP in Friesian horses is at least partly a result of inbreeding.

Sevinga M, Barkema HW, Stryhn H, Hesselink JW. Retained placenta in Friesian mares: incidence, and potential risk factors with special emphasis on gestational length. Theriogenology 2004; 61:851-9. [PMID: 14757471 DOI: 10.1016/s0093-691x(03)00260-7] [Citation(s) in RCA: 37] [Impact Index Per Article: 1.9]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 10/27/2022]
Abstract
During the foaling seasons of 1999 and 2000, the incidence of retained placenta in 495 normal parturitions of 436 Friesian brood mares was studied. Retained placenta was defined as a failure to expel all fetal membranes within 3 h of the delivery of the foal. Furthermore, the sex of the foal, month of breeding, sire and dam's sire, age of the mare, and time of day of foaling, were studied as factors that might be associated with retained placenta in Friesian mares after normal foalings, and with gestational length. The analysis was carried out using marginal logistic regression, and mixed linear regression, respectively. The incidence of retained placenta was 54%. Mean length of gestation was 331.6 days. Colts were carried 1.5 days longer than fillies. Mares bred in July-September had a 4-day shorter gestation period (329 days) than mares bred earlier in the year. There was a mare, sire, and dam's sire effect on gestational length, and a mare effect on the occurrence of retained placenta. Mares foaling at 4 and >17 years of age, tended to have a lower incidence of retained placenta than mares foaling at 5-17 years of age. No association was found between the occurrence of retained placenta, and gestational length, sex of the foal, month of breeding, dam's sire, and time of day of foaling. It was concluded that the observed high incidence of retained placenta indicates that the Friesian breed of horses has a higher risk for retained placenta than other breeds of horses.

Drillich M, Pfützner A, Sabin HJ, Sabin M, Heuwieser W. Comparison of two protocols for the treatment of retained fetal membranes in dairy cattle. Theriogenology 2003; 59:951-60. [PMID: 12517396 DOI: 10.1016/s0093-691x(02)01132-9] [Citation(s) in RCA: 39] [Impact Index Per Article: 1.9]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 10/27/2022]
Abstract
Two protocols for the treatment of retained fetal membranes in dairy cattle were evaluated in a field trial. Cows that retained the fetal membranes for more than 12h were assigned to two treatment groups in an alternating order. In both groups rectal temperature was measured daily for 10 days after enrollment. In Group 1 (n=35) cows with a rectal temperature >or=39.5 degrees C received a systemic antibiotic treatment with 600mg ceftiofur intramuscularly on three consecutive days. No manual removal of the fetal membranes or intrauterine treatment was conducted. In case of elevated temperature of >or=39.5 degrees C on Day 3 treatment was conducted for another 2 days. In Group 2 (n=35) cows received a local antibiotic treatment (2500 mg ampicillin, 2500 mg cloxacillin) and an attempt was made to remove the fetal membranes manually. In case of a rectal temperature >or=39.5 degrees C 6000 mg of ampicillin were administered intramuscularly. Treatment was repeated on three consecutive days. If temperature did not decrease below 39.5 degrees C systemic treatment was extended for another 2 days. During 10 days of observation 33 and 34 cows showed fever, i.e. a body temperature >or=39.5 degrees C in Groups 1 and 2, respectively (94.3 versus 97.1%). The proportion of cows considered as cured (temperature <39.5 degrees C on Day 10 after enrollment) was 65.7 and 68.6% in Groups 1 and 2, respectively. All cows showed signs of chronic inflammation of the genital tract on Day 14 after calving. Within 4 weeks postpartum three (8.6%) and four (11.4%) cows were culled in Groups 1 and 2, respectively. Days to first service and days open did not differ significantly between the groups. Proportion of cows pregnant on Day 200 postpartum was 71.4 and 54.3% for Groups 1 and 2, respectively (P>0.05). Results indicate that treatment of retained fetal membranes without intrauterine manipulation and treatment can be as effective as conventional treatment including detachment and local antibiotic treatment.

Kimura K, Goff JP, Kehrli ME, Reinhardt TA. Decreased neutrophil function as a cause of retained placenta in dairy cattle. J Dairy Sci 2002; 85:544-50. [PMID: 11949858 DOI: 10.3168/jds.s0022-0302(02)74107-6] [Citation(s) in RCA: 178] [Impact Index Per Article: 8.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/19/2022]
Abstract
It is unclear why some cows fail to expel the placenta following calving. One theory suggests the fetal placenta must be recognized as "foreign" tissue and rejected by the immune system after parturition to cause expulsion of the placenta. We hypothesized that impaired neutrophil function causes retained placenta (RP). We examined the ability of neutrophils to recognize fetal cotyledon tissue as assessed by a chemotaxis assay, which utilized a placental homogenate obtained from a spontaneously expelled placenta as the chemoattractant. Neutrophil killing ability was also estimated by determining myeloperoxidase activity in isolated neutrophils. Blood samples were obtained from 142 periparturient dairy cattle in two herds. Twenty cattle developed RP (14.1%). Neutrophils isolated from blood of cows with RP had significantly lower neutrophil function in both assays before calving, and this impaired function lasted for 1 to 2 wk after parturition. The addition of antibody directed against interleukin-8 (IL-8) to the cotyledon preparation used as a chemoattractant inhibited chemotaxis by 41%, suggesting that one of the chemoattractants present in the cotyledon at parturition is IL-8. At calving, plasma IL-8 concentration was lower in RP cows (51 +/- 12 pg/ml) than in cows expelling the placenta normally (134 +/- 11 pg/ml). From these data, we suggest that neutrophil function is a determining factor for the development of RP in dairy cattle. Also, depressed production of IL-8 may be a factor affecting neutrophil function in cows developing RP.

Miyoshi M, Sawamukai Y, Iwanaga T. Reduced phagocytotic activity of macrophages in the bovine retained placenta. Reprod Domest Anim 2002; 37:53-6. [PMID: 11882246 DOI: 10.1046/j.1439-0531.2002.00332.x] [Citation(s) in RCA: 30] [Impact Index Per Article: 1.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/20/2022]
Abstract
This study was carried out to investigate the distribution of immune cells in the bovine placenta during the postpartum period and to compare these cells between normal and retained placenta. Within 1 h after normal calving, biopsy samples of placentomes were collected from 10 cows. The occurrence of retention of fetal membranes was monitored for more than 8 h post-calving, and the samples obtained were divided into two groups: normally discharged and retained placenta (n = 5 each). Immunohistochemical procedures were utilized to detect macrophages and T lymphocytes. Numerous CD14-positive macrophages were found in the stroma of both normal placenta and retained placenta whereas only a few CD3-positive T lymphocytes were found in both cases. However, histochemical staining for acid phosphatase, a predominant lysozomal enzyme, revealed that almost all macrophages showed strong enzyme activity in the normally discharged placentas, whereas in retained placenta the activity of acid phosphatase was conspicuously decreased in intensity. These results indicate that there are functional differences in placental macrophages between normal and retained placenta.
